2000 Lincoln LS V8 Manual Conversion for Sale

(Madisonville, LA 70447)

The Good:
119000 Original Miles - However everything on the car has been replaced or well maintained.
2004 Lincoln LS 3.9 engine
2007 Mustang 5speed with upgraded gears
1999 8.8 3.55:1 limited slip (new frictions and gears)
2 Piece 1000 horsepower steel driveshaft
SCT Tuner with Manual Tune
2007 Jaguar S-Type R 14" brakes and EBC Redstuff Pads

The Bad:
No start: Bad PCM
Interior is nice but showing a little age. Seat belts are dingy looking an there is a small scratch in headliner where my old detailer was testing is new scrub brush.

No expense has been spared on the Lincoln. Recently the PCM went out and the car will not start. I do not have time to work on this project anymore.

Background - This Lincoln is my baby. I wanted this to be my car for all time use. I have put countless hours and dollars into this car. This Lincoln has always started and been extremely dependable though all of the customization. Then while on a work trip to Houston the PCM went out. I shipped it back to 70447 in Louisiana and it now sits in my garage.

I purchased the 2003 Jaguar to swap over the suspension and the supercharger. The Jaguar has 170K has a bad motor. I pulled the exhaust off of the Jaguar and put it on the Lincoln. Also, I removed the supercharger but it will go with the car. The supercharger is dirty but still in excellent condition. With a replaced motor and exhaust system the Jaguar would be up and running.



The Lincoln interior is Medium Parchment (light beige) and in decent condition. Original radio. The Shifter and conversion looks like it came factory.
